Transaction 507211a947648169ad90dabef4fe1cf058d091c3ed34a964cc98e3e46ffa9ea5

1 Input
2 Outputs
  • 507211a947648169ad90dabef4fe1cf058d091c3ed34a964cc98e3e46ffa9ea5:0
  • value  255421377
    address  mkHZJuXALC7tiJMiofsSo2LoH8Q476Expm
  • 507211a947648169ad90dabef4fe1cf058d091c3ed34a964cc98e3e46ffa9ea5:1
  • value  30000000
    address  my6FL92467QY6G3cVQemVYAcFhde6Wotqw